void __dt_fixup_mac_addresses(u32 startindex, ...)
{
	va_list ap;
	u32 index = startindex;
	const u8 *addr;

	va_start(ap, startindex);

	while ((addr = va_arg(ap, const u8 *)))
		dt_fixup_mac_address(index++, addr);

	va_end(ap);
}

static void katmai_fixups(void)
{
    unsigned long sysclk = 33333000;

    /* 440SP Clock logic is all but identical to 440GX
     * so we just use that code for now at least
     */
    ibm440spe_fixup_clocks(sysclk, 6 * 1843200, 0);

    ibm440spe_fixup_memsize();

    dt_fixup_mac_address(0, bd.bi_enetaddr);

    ibm4xx_fixup_ebc_ranges("/plb/opb/ebc");
}
void planetcore_set_mac_addrs(const char *table)
{
	u8 addr[4][6];
	u64 int_addr;
	u32 i;
	int j;

	if (!planetcore_get_hex(table, PLANETCORE_KEY_MAC_ADDR, &int_addr))
		return;

	for (i = 0; i < 4; i++) {
		u64 this_dev_addr = (int_addr & ~0x000000c00000) |
		                    mac_table[i];

		for (j = 5; j >= 0; j--) {
			addr[i][j] = this_dev_addr & 0xff;
			this_dev_addr >>= 8;
		}

		dt_fixup_mac_address(i, addr[i]);
	}
}
